The ingredients needed to make Vegetarian red curry soup:
  1. Prepare 1 onion
  2. Prepare 1-2 tbs red curry paste
  3. Take 1 tin coconut milk
  4. Take 1 clove garlic
  5. Take 300 ml water
  6. Make ready 1 tsp fish sauce
  7. Make ready 1 tin chickpeas
  8. Prepare 1 tin sweetcorn
  9. Get 1/2 pack sugar snap peas
  10. Take Optional
  11. Take 2 squares of egg noodles

Instructions to make Vegetarian red curry soup:
  1. Chop and fry onions and garlic. Add curry paste and fry for another minute. Add coconut milk, water, chickpeas and sweetcorn and simmer for 5 minutes.
  2. If you want noodles, add them to the soup now, together with the sugar anap peas, and boil until they're done. If you dont want noodles, skip them and serve the soup as it is or with some rice. Enjoy!
